BNY Advisor Match is a strategic opportunity for BNY to build a digital referral program that will capture a share of the massive $80T wealth transfer over the coming decade. It is a new service designed to connect investors with financial advisors through trusted referral channels, enterprise partnerships, and digital experiences. As BNY scales Advisor Match, a critical priority is building a diversified, high-quality pipeline of demand through strategic partnerships. This includes relationships across financial services, workplace and benefits providers, platforms, and adjacent industries that can serve as consistent sources of qualified client introductions. This role will focus on identifying, shaping, and activating these partnerships-translating market opportunities into structured, scalable growth channels for the platform.
